Do you have your system automatically reboot on a system failure? Go to the System applet in the Control Panel, look at the Advanced tab and "startup and recovery." You'll see a place where you can check "automatically reboot." If you uncheck this box you'll be able to see what program is causing the problem.
If the problem is with a service that is set to automatically start, one way to fix this is to boot from the Win2k CDROM and load up the Recovery Console. You'll see what looks like a command prompt and then you can disable the service that is causing your computer to crash. I don't remember what the exact commands are but if you type "help" or something like that you'll get a list of commands you can use.
